The difference between Oracle Sequence
Generator and Informatica Sequence Generator?
Which is faster in performance?
Which is best to use?

Good question,

Informatica Sequence Gen, uses its server cache and generates the sequence numbers and uses it along with the load, which happens at the same time, remember it will use the Informatica Cache, which is comparatively not that big with transformations like Lookup and others....  Advantage is very easy to create and use it when we are inserting into "multiple targets"!, Infa seq is part and parcel of mapping(s).

but in case of Oracle Sequence, we need to maintain it separately along with tables and other objects, and the main question is how will you access it everytime in every mapping? solution is there, but do you recommend it?
